在現(xiàn)代數(shù)字時代,網(wǎng)頁制作已經(jīng)成為一項重要技能。無論是個人博客、企業(yè)網(wǎng)站還是電子商務平臺,了解和掌握網(wǎng)頁制作工具都能夠使我們更有效地創(chuàng)建和管理網(wǎng)站。從簡單的拖拽式編輯器到復雜的開發(fā)環(huán)境,各種工具可供選擇。本文將介紹一些主要的網(wǎng)頁制作軟件工具,幫助您選擇最適合的解決方案。
1. HTML/CSS 編輯器
1.1 Sublime Text
Sublime Text 是一款功能強大的文本編輯器,支持多種編程語言,包括HTML和CSS。它具有便捷的代碼高亮和自動完成功能,支持插件擴展,可以提高開發(fā)效率。雖然Sublime Text是免費試用的,但如果您持續(xù)使用,建議購買正版以支持開發(fā)者。
1.2 Visual Studio Code
Visual Studio Code 是微軟推出的一款免費的開源代碼編輯器。它不僅支持HTML和CSS,還可以處理JavaScript、PHP和Python等多種語言。憑借其豐富的插件生態(tài)系統(tǒng)和集成的Git支持,VS Code已經(jīng)成為許多開發(fā)者的首選工具。
2. 拖拽式網(wǎng)站構建工具
2.1 Wix
Wix 是一個流行的在線網(wǎng)站構建平臺,允許用戶無需編碼知識即可創(chuàng)建專業(yè)網(wǎng)站。其直觀的拖拽界面和豐富的模板庫,使得即使是初學者也能快速搭建起自己的網(wǎng)站。Wix提供了多種擴展功能,適用于不同種類的業(yè)務需求。
2.2 Squarespace
Squarespace 是另一個知名的拖拽式網(wǎng)站構建工具,以其優(yōu)雅的模板和用戶友好的界面而廣受歡迎。它特別適合需要展示作品的創(chuàng)意專業(yè)人士,如攝影師、設計師和藝術家。盡管價格相對較高,但Squarespace提供的設計質(zhì)量值得投資。
3. 內(nèi)容管理系統(tǒng) (CMS)
3.1 WordPress
WordPress 是目前使用最廣泛的內(nèi)容管理系統(tǒng)(CMS),其開源特性使得用戶能夠通過豐富的主題和插件定制網(wǎng)站。無論是個人博客還是企業(yè)網(wǎng)站,WordPress都能滿足各種需求。即使沒有編程經(jīng)驗,用戶也可以通過直觀的界面輕松創(chuàng)建和管理內(nèi)容。
3.2 Joomla
Joomla 是另一個開源CMS,適合于需要更復雜結構的網(wǎng)站。盡管其學習曲線相對陡峭,但Joomla在擴展功能和靈活性方面具有無可比擬的優(yōu)勢。它特別適合需要復雜用戶管理和內(nèi)容組織的網(wǎng)站,如社區(qū)論壇和社交網(wǎng)絡。
4. 開發(fā)框架和工具
4.1 Bootstrap
Bootstrap 是一個流行的前端開發(fā)框架,專注于快速創(chuàng)建響應式網(wǎng)站。它提供了一組樣式和組件,使開發(fā)者能夠快速構建美觀且易于使用的網(wǎng)頁。Bootstrap的流行成就了大量基于其構建的模板和主題,廣泛應用于各類項目中。
4.2 React.js
React.js 是由Facebook開發(fā)的一個前端JavaScript庫,專注于用戶界面的構建。雖然相對復雜,但它提供了構建動態(tài)網(wǎng)頁所需的高效架構。React.js的組合式設計使得代碼更具可重用性,適合大型應用的開發(fā)。
5. 圖形設計工具
5.1 Adobe XD
Adobe XD 是一款設計和原型制作工具,適合網(wǎng)頁和移動應用界面的設計。它具有直觀的界面,支持快速原型制作和交互設計。Adobe XD的共享和協(xié)作功能可以大幅提升開發(fā)團隊的工作效率。
5.2 Figma
Figma 是一個云端設計工具,允許團隊成員實時協(xié)作。它支持多種平臺,能夠方便地進行設計和原型制作。Figma因其團隊協(xié)作功能而逐漸受到設計師的青睞,尤其在需要大量反饋的項目中表現(xiàn)出色。
6. 數(shù)據(jù)庫管理工具
6.1 MySQL
MySQL 是一種流行的開源關系數(shù)據(jù)庫管理系統(tǒng),廣泛用于存儲和管理網(wǎng)頁數(shù)據(jù)。許多網(wǎng)站都依賴MySQL來支持動態(tài)內(nèi)容和用戶交互。結合PHP等后端語言,MySQL能夠構建強大的數(shù)據(jù)庫驅(qū)動網(wǎng)站。
6.2 MongoDB
MongoDB 是一種NoSQL數(shù)據(jù)庫,適合處理大數(shù)據(jù)和非結構化數(shù)據(jù)。對于需要高吞吐量和低延遲的應用程序,MongoDB提供了靈活的數(shù)據(jù)存儲和查詢方式。它在大數(shù)據(jù)和實時應用的開發(fā)中越來越受歡迎。
7. 測試和調(diào)試工具
7.1 Chrome DevTools
Chrome DevTools 是Google Chrome瀏覽器內(nèi)置的開發(fā)者工具,對于網(wǎng)頁開發(fā)和調(diào)試至關重要。它提供了強大的實時編輯、調(diào)試JavaScript和網(wǎng)絡請求分析等功能,使開發(fā)者能夠快速識別和解決問題。
7.2 Postman
Postman 是一個功能強大的API測試工具,可以幫助開發(fā)者設計和調(diào)試他們的API。Postman的用戶友好界面和強大的功能,使得它成為后端開發(fā)和測試工作流中不可或缺的工具。
無論您是初學者還是經(jīng)驗豐富的開發(fā)者,以上提到的網(wǎng)頁制作軟件工具都能助您高效地創(chuàng)建和管理網(wǎng)站。選擇最適合自己的工具,可以提高工作效率、降低學習成本,進而創(chuàng)造出令人滿意的網(wǎng)頁體驗。在這一多元化的工具環(huán)境中,利用好這些資源,將讓您的網(wǎng)頁制作之旅變得更加順利和愉悅。